Lord, Have Mercy is about a woman named Grace, who is a very loving and devoted mother and wife to her family. She is well respected throughout her community. Only her family knows that she’s gifted (physic). Her seemingly perfect life began to quickly unravel when her eight-year-old baby girl Sarah Jane becomes the obsession of a serial killer. He would stop at nothing until he got Sarah to be his wife! The killer is someone that no one would ever have suspected. It makes you wonder what kinds of monsters are lurking in the neighborhood.

Grace dealt with so much over that year. Sarah was not only stalked by a serial killer; she had a brain tumor that was cancerous, and she had a massive stroke, and she had to learn everything all over again.

Grace was attacked, raped, and beaten by her husband. She lost two children and almost a third. Her marriage crumbled to the point of no repair. Her house was burned to ashes. Everything bad that could happen to a person happened to her that year like a domino effect one after the next.

Grace weathered every storm and braced herself for the next. She survived with a new outlook on life. She realized that life is short and every moment she had left with her remaining six kids was priceless. To everyone’s surprise, she wasn’t this poor, struggling, divorced, pitiful, scorned woman with six kids that didn’t know where her next meal was coming from. They all were wrong! Grace was a millionaire, but no one ever knew it.
